The Admission modalities are with reference to the 5-Year BBA-LLB(Hons.) offered by Faculty of Law of the ICFAI Foundation for Higher Education (IFHE).

Eligibility Criteria

Applicants should not be more than 20 years of age as on the last date for receipt of applications.

  • Pass in 10+2 or equivalent examination with an aggregate 60% and above (any discipline) in English medium.
  • National-level Common Law Admission Test (CLAT)/State Level Law Entrance Test scores are also accepted, but they are not mandatory.

The applicant should fulfill the minimum age requirements as prescribed by the respective board through which the applicant has appeared for the qualifying examination.

If an applicant is found ineligible even at a later date, after admission into the program, his/her admission will be cancelled. All admissions will be subject to verification of facts from the original certificates/ documents of the students. The decision of the Admissions Committee regarding eligibility of any applicant shall be final. 

The selected applicants will be sent selection letters on June 01, 2012 and will be given Provisional Admission. The provisional admission is subject to payment of admission fee.

Applicants who have appeared for final year 10+2 examination and awaiting results are also eligible to apply provided they complete their examinations (including practical examinations) before July 01, 2012. The admission of applicants will, however remain provisional until they produce marksheets establishing their eligibility. The last date for submitting the proof of 10+2 marksheet is August 31, 2012, failing which the provisional admission will automatically stand cancelled.

Selection Process

The selection for the program is made through application and personal interviews. Eligible applicants are required to apply for the program using the Application Form and the shortlisted candidates will be called for personal interview. Due weightage will be given to academic distinctions, achievements in sports and extra-curricular and co-curricular activities.

Interviews

The shortlisted candidates will be called for personal interview between May 21-25, 2012 at Hyderabad. The interview for each candidate will be completed in one day.

The interview panel will focus on testing the attitude, aptitude and aspiration of the candidates. Original certificates should be produced for verification at the time of interview along with one photocopy. The original certificates will be returned after verification. The admission decision will be communicated by June 01, 2012.

Payment Schedule

Applicants selected for the BBA-LLB (Hons.) Program of IFHE, Hyderabad are required to pay the fee as follows.

Admission Fee

The Admission Fee of   20,000 is to be paid by all the selected students of BBA-LLB (Hons.) Program on or before June 15, 2012.

Program Fee for BBA-LLB (Hons.) Program (10 semesters)

The Program fee is   80,000 per semester.

Students are required to pay the fee at the beginning of each semester, as per the due dates which will be indicated in the Student Handbook. The first semester fee is to be paid on or before July 16, 2012.

Caution Deposit

Students of BBA-LLB (Hons.) Program are required to pay a caution deposit of  10,000 payable in equal instalments of   5,000 each along with the first semester and the second semester fee. This deposit is towards use of library books, computers, labs and other facilities. The caution deposit will be refunded without interest (and after adjusting for dues, if any) to the students on completion of the respective program.

Accommodation and Transportation for Students

Limited hostel rooms are available at IFHE. However, Day scholars can avail bus facility from city (Punjagutta X road) to campus on Shankarpally road on payment basis.

Alumni Society Membership Fee

The alumni fee for the BBA-LLB (Hons.) students is  15,000 payable along with the tenth semester fee.
